I. Why Do We Need Miniature Monitoring Prisms?

In tunnel monitoring or building deformation monitoring, traditional large-volume prisms often face the awkward situation of being "unfit for use." The curved structure of tunnel walls, the dense gaps in scaffolding, and the narrow spaces of pilot tunnels all place stringent requirements on the size of measuring equipment. Traditional prisms, due to their large size, are difficult to install effectively in confined spaces, and cannot guarantee the continuity and accuracy of measurement data.

The 25mm Tilting Mini Prism addresses this industry pain point. Its miniature design, with a diameter of only 25mm, allows for easy embedding into various complex installation points, truly achieving "fitting into any available space." Whether it's the end of an anchor bolt in a tunnel wall or the gaps in the reinforcing steel in a foundation pit, this miniature prism enables rapid and stable installation, laying a solid foundation for subsequent automated monitoring.

Key Advantages of the 25mm Tilting Mini Prism:

1. "Precise Embedding" in Space-Confined Environments: In tunnel construction environments, space resources are extremely precious. The 25mm Tilting Mini Prism, with its ultra-compact design, can function in locations where traditional prisms cannot be installed. Its lightweight structure (typically less than 200g) not only reduces the burden on surveyors but also lowers the load requirements on the installation point, making installation possible in fragile surrounding rock or temporary support structures.

2. Tilting Adjustment Function Ensures Strongest Signal Reflection: Curved tunnel walls or irregular mounting surfaces often prevent the prism from being directly aligned with the total station, affecting signal reflection intensity and data quality. The 25mm Tilting Mini Prism is equipped with a professional tilting holder, supporting flexible multi-angle adjustments to ensure the prism mirror is always directly facing the measuring instrument. This design significantly improves signal reception efficiency, providing stable, high-intensity reflected signals even in dimly lit, low-visibility tunnel environments, ensuring millimeter-level measurement accuracy.

3. High Durability Design for Harsh Environments: Tunnel interiors are humid, dusty, and experience significant temperature variations, placing extremely high demands on the protective performance of measuring equipment. The 25mm Tilting Mini Prism features a fully sealed structure, meeting IP67 waterproof and dustproof standards, effectively resisting moisture intrusion and dust adhesion. Whether facing the humid environment of water inrush sections or the dust storms after blasting, this miniature prism maintains the cleanliness and stability of its internal optical components, ensuring the continuity and reliability of long-term monitoring data.

4. Optical Accuracy and Constant Stability

As a core component of high-precision monitoring, the 25mm Tilting Mini Prism also excels in optical performance. Its prism constant (e.g., -30mm or -17.5mm) is precisely calibrated, ensuring extremely high factory consistency and perfect compatibility with mainstream total stations from brands such as Leica, Topcon, and Sokkia. This stable optical performance ensures the comparability of data collected at different times and locations, providing a reliable basis for deformation analysis.

Wide Range of Applications and Practical Performance

Tunnel Convergence Deformation Monitoring

During tunnel construction, monitoring surrounding rock deformation is a crucial aspect of ensuring safety. The 25mm Tilting Mini Prism can be densely deployed near the tunnel arch, sidewalls, and working face, enabling real-time monitoring around the clock through an automated total station system. Its compact size allows for a significant increase in deployment density, enabling monitoring personnel to more accurately grasp the changing trends of the surrounding rock, provide timely warnings of safety risks, and offer data support for the dynamic adjustment of support parameters.


High-Rise Building and Foundation Pit Tilting Monitoring

In urban deep foundation pit construction and super high-rise building deformation monitoring, the concealed installation advantages of the 25mm Tilting Mini Prism are particularly prominent. Compared to traditional prisms, it can be easily fixed to steel structure nodes, concrete surfaces, or temporary support systems with minimal construction interference. Combined with tilt adjustment functionality, even with minor displacement of the building structure, the prism maintains the optimal reflection angle, ensuring the authenticity and accuracy of monitoring data.

Mining Tunnel and Underground Engineering Surveying

Mining tunnels are complex environments with confined spaces and uneven terrain. The lightweight design of the 25mm Tilting Mini Prism (typically less than 200g) greatly reduces the burden on surveyors, and its miniature size allows it to adapt to various irregular installation surfaces within the mine. Whether for daily monitoring of the working face or stability assessment of goaf areas, this miniature prism plays an irreplaceable role.

Purchase Guide: How to Choose the Right 25mm Tilting Mini Prism?

For professionals seeking high-precision monitoring prisms, the following three dimensions are recommended for consideration:

1. Constant Consistency: The prism constant is a core parameter affecting measurement accuracy. High-quality products should ensure accurate and stable factory constants (e.g., -30mm or -17.5mm), with high batch-to-batch consistency to avoid data errors caused by constant deviations.

2. Installation Flexibility: An excellent 25mm Tilting Mini Prism should support 360° rotation adjustment and be equipped with a quick-release clamping mechanism for easy on-site installation and disassembly. Flexible installation methods significantly improve work efficiency and reduce labor costs.

3. Protection Rating: The harsh environments of tunnels and underground engineering projects necessitate IP67 waterproof and dustproof ratings as a basic requirement. Only prisms with high-level protection capabilities can maintain stable performance during long-term monitoring, reducing maintenance frequency.
